Evaluation Theories
Evaluation theories are akin to military strategy and tactics. A good evaluator needs theories to choose and deploy methods. The evaluator is concerned with models and theories of evaluation. The major streams of evaluation are: why theories matter, frameworks for classifying multiple theories, in-depth examination of 4-6 major theories, identification of key issues on which evaluation theories and models differ, benefits and risks of relying heavily on any one theory, and tools and skills that can help you in picking and choosing from different theoretical perspectives in planning an evaluation in a specific context.

Teaching Adult Learners
Teachers, educators, and seminar facilitators that deal with adult learners usually face a number of challenges. First, adult learners may have years of working experience. Most of them fall into the 30- to 40-year age bracket. They also come from all walks of life. Lastly, they are usually keen learners, since they decided to participate on a learning seminar or program because they wanted to. For that reason, they tend to set high standards for their teachers or seminar facilitators. That is why they usually demand an expert to guide them in their learning endeavors. But these challenges can easily be managed by comprehensive and updated academic content, proper teaching techniques, and a prepared facilitator.

What Is Mnemonics?
If you have to memorize a list of long, complicated names that make no sense, you’re not alone. A lot of people have to do this. This is where mnemonics can help.
What are mnemonics? Basically, mnemonics are devices that help you remember otherwise disjointed facts that might not hang together in your noggin for easy memorization. One popular mnemonic that helps you remember a month’s number of days, for example, is, “30 days hath September, April June and November. All the rest have 31, excepting February alone; which hath but 28 in fine, till leap year gives it 29.”
